Neuropathology of focal epilepsies : An Atlas

Interdisciplinary co-operation between epileptologists, neuroradiologists, psychologists and neurosurgeons is

the most fundamental prerequisite for localising and performing targeted resections of epileptogenic foci from

patients with focal therapy-resistant epilepsy. Worldwide there has been a steady increase in the number of

epilepsy surgery centres, and in the number of operations performed on children and babies.

A systematic neuropathological description is presented here involving macroscopic and histological findings.

In this book, a systematic documentation of characteristic as well as rarer alterations is presented involving 444 patients

who had been operated on in Germany between 1990 and 1997 at the Bethel Epilepsy Centre in Bielefeld. It includes 257 patients

with temporal lobe (TLE) and 187 patients with extratemporal epilepsy (ETE).
